Summary: The role of KYC Analyst involves joining a leading global financial services firm's compliance team in Belfast, focusing on KYC and AML processes. The position is ideal for candidates with 2-3 years of relevant experience who seek to enhance their regulatory knowledge in a collaborative environment. Key responsibilities include conducting due diligence, verifying documentation, and maintaining client records. The role offers an initial 6-month contract with potential for extension.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ct KYC due diligence on new and existing clients in line with internal policies and regulatory standards
  • Review and verify customer documentation, ensuring accurate data capture and risk classification
  • Liaise with internal stakeholders (Sales, Legal, Compliance) to resolve queries and support onboarding timelines
  • Maintain and update client records, ensuring consistency and audit readiness
  • Assist with periodic reviews and ongoing monitoring for AML compliance

Key Skills:

  • 2-3 years of experience in a KYC or AML-focused role within financial services
  • Strong understanding of due diligence requirements and regulatory frameworks (FCA, MiFID, AMLD)
  • Excellent attention to detail and a methodical approach to compliance tasks
  • Confident communicator with the ability to work cross-functionally
  • Experience with client onboarding platforms or workflow tools is a plus
